Why It Matters

A recent Congressional Research Service report examines the Navy's MQ-25 Stingray program, a carrier-based uncrewed aerial vehicle designed to perform aerial refueling and intelligence, surveillance, and reconnaissance missions. The MQ-25 Stingray would be the Defense Department's first uncrewed aerial refueling system.

But the Government Accountability Office cautions that starting Low-Rate Initial Production (LRIP), which is a defense acquisition term for producing a small initial quantity of a military system, before adequate testing is finished will create a cost risk.

The Big Picture

The MQ-25 traces its lineage to a 1999 Navy and Defense Advanced Research Projects Agency initiative for a carrier-based uncrewed combat aircraft. The Navy shifted the program's focus from combat to refueling missions in 2016, and Boeing was selected as the prime contractor in 2018. The first developmental flight occurred in April, with the Navy approving low-rate initial production in May.

The first flight was originally planned for 2021. Under a revised baseline adopted in 2024, it was postponed to 2025. Initial operational capability is now estimated at 2029, representing a four-year delay from the original plan and a two-year slip from the 2024 revised schedule. The Navy attributes these delays to production challenges stemming from technical risk, schedule changes, and a labor strike.

The cost picture is equally complex. The Defense Department's 2026 Modernized Selected Acquisition Report estimated total acquisition cost at $19.4 billion, with a unit cost of $255.8 million per aircraft. The GAO's 2026 estimate of $16.6 billion represents a 4% increase from the GAO's 2025 estimate. The GAO attributed part of the cost growth to Navy efforts to replace obsolete components.

A significant concern emerged from a 2023 Defense Department Inspector General audit warning that the Navy's plan to begin low-rate initial production before completing developmental and operational testing posed significant risk of future cost increases and delays. The Navy proceeded anyway, beginning production in May. Testing is projected to continue through the end of fiscal year 2029. The GAO has similarly warned of cost risks if production continues ahead of sufficient testing, noting this concurrency problem has historically plagued major defense programs.

The Bottom Line

Congress previously provided $100 million in mandatory fiscal year 2025 funding to accelerate production under the reconciliation law, but the Defense Department did not request reconciliation funding for the fiscal year 2027 cycle. The program of record calls for 76 total aircraft, including 67 operational and nine test and developmental platforms.
